The 2011 edition of the International Festival of Londrina (FILO) has transformed the north of Paraná in a great stage for the performing arts. The event has completed 43 years, establishing itself as the oldest of the gender in Latin America. The FILO 2011 had a schedule of 12 shows and 35 international and local productions.
Having the diversity, culture and arts as the main concepts of the brand, the studio explored them using textures and abstracts shapes in the compositions. For the festival were developed graphic designs as poster, invitation, booklet and the 2011 catalog.
